[Dy2stat] Fix lstm bug (#27631)
This PR fixed two bugs when converting LSTM in dy2stat: is_unsupported has a condition can trigger Python syntax error LSTM API's implementation in _rnn_static_graph doesn't include parameter initialization, which can cause dy2stat error.my_2.0rc
